NOKIA Dividend FAQ
As of June 2026, NOKIA's dividend yield is 2.64%. This is calculated by dividing the trailing 12-month dividend rate (TTM rate) of 0.14 EUR by the current share price of 12.04.
As of June 2026, NOKIA paid a dividend of 0.14 EUR in the last 12 months. The last dividend was paid on 2026-04-27 and the payout was 0.04 EUR.
NOKIA pays dividends quarterly. Over the last 12 months, NOKIA has issued 4 dividend payments. The last dividend payment was made on 2026-04-27.
Based on historical data, the forecasted dividends per share for NOKIA for the next payments are between 0.038 (-5.0%) and 0.044 (+10.0%). This suggests the dividend will remain relatively stable. The expected Yield for the next 12 months is about 1.35%.
The latest dividend paid per share was 0.04 EUR with an Ex-Dividend Date of 2026-04-27. The next Ex-Dividend date for Nokia (NOKIA) is currently unknown.
The next Ex-Dividend date for Nokia (NOKIA) is currently unknown. We automatically update the next Ex-Dividend date when it is announced.
NOKIA's average dividend growth rate over the past 5 years is 16.3% per year. Strong growth: NOKIA's dividend growth is outpacing inflation.
NOKIA's 5-Year Yield on Cost is 3.65%. If you bought NOKIA's shares at 3.83 EUR five years ago, your current annual dividend income (0.14 EUR per share, trailing 12 months) equals 3.65% of your original purchase price.
NOKIA Payout Consistency is 100.0%. The payout consistency is a proprietary measure of how consistently a company has paid dividends over its lifetime and blends growth rate, number of dividend payments, interruptions or lowering dividends into one number. Very consistent: Nokia has a strong track record of consistent dividend payments over its lifetime.
NOKIA's 2.64% Dividend Yield is considered as moderate. This is usually a sign of a value company.
The Dividend Payout Ratio of NOKIA is 48.3%. Healthy - Leaves room for growth and provides some protection to maintain dividends even in a recession.
NOKIA's Overall Dividend Rating is 71.55%. Ratings surpassing 65% are regarded as acceptable, exceeding 75% are favorable and surpassing 85% are strong.
